Home Improvement in Delaware

Delaware's lack of sales tax on materials makes it a surprisingly cost-effective state for large renovation projects, saving homeowners 6-8% compared to neighboring Pennsylvania and Maryland. The state's small size means most areas are within reach of Philadelphia and Baltimore contractor markets, providing competitive pricing. Coastal Sussex County has become a retirement destination, driving steady demand for aging-in-place modifications and bathroom accessibility upgrades.

Climate Considerations for Delaware Projects

Delaware's low-lying coastal plain is vulnerable to flooding and storm surge, and many properties in Sussex and Kent counties fall within FEMA flood zones requiring elevated construction. Salt air corrosion affects homes within several miles of the Atlantic coast, making stainless steel fasteners and marine-grade finishes a necessity rather than a luxury. The mid-Atlantic climate brings moderate snowfall but significant freeze-thaw cycling that degrades concrete, masonry, and exterior paint systems.

Contractor Licensing in Delaware

Delaware does not require a general contractor license at the state level, but contractors performing mechanical, electrical, or plumbing work must hold specialty licenses from the Division of Professional Regulation. Sussex County and the city of Wilmington have local contractor registration requirements. Delaware law does require that contractors provide written contracts for projects over $5,000 and maintain liability insurance.
